Overview ⁞ Tiverton and Minehead span rural Devon and Somerset, combining market towns, moorland, and coastline. Tiverton lies on the River Exe with a castle, canal, and historic centre, while Minehead is a seaside resort with a sandy beach and harbour. The area includes Exmoor National Park, offering heather-covered hills, wooded valleys, and coastal cliffs. This region is rich in outdoor activities and heritage sites.

Population by age group

The most recent data for constituencies in England and Wales comes from mid-year estimates for 2022. This tells us what the population was estimated to be on 30 June 2022.

Population by age group, June 2022
Age Band Constituency (Number) Constituency (%) Region (Number) Region (%) England & Wales (Number) England & Wales (%)
0 to 17 16,294 17.68% 1,095,190 19.00% 12,506,535 20.76%
18 to 24 5,290 5.74% 469,949 8.15% 5,008,522 8.31%
25 to 34 8,352 9.06% 691,220 11.99% 8,098,257 13.44%
35 to 49 14,296 15.51% 1,028,221 17.84% 11,575,752 19.22%
50 to 64 21,036 22.83% 1,179,220 20.46% 11,745,365 19.50%
65 and over 26,884 29.17% 1,301,081 22.57% 11,303,607 18.76%

Tiverton and Minehead compared with other constituencies

Tiverton and Minehead has a population of 93,065 (2024 mid-year estimate by ONS). The population of the UK is 69,281,400 as of mid-2024. There are 650 constituencies, so the average population per constituency is around 106,600.

Compared with the other 649 constituencies, Tiverton and Minehead has a population higher than 19, lower than 559, and similar to 72 constituencies (±2,500, including itself).
